The Yorkshire Ripper, Peter Sutcliffe, is being questioned by police over 17 historic unsolved cases, ranging from the 1970s to the ‘80s.
Detectives have interrogated the serial killer at Durham prison, after the release of a book in 2015, which claimed to link Sutcliffe to 23 unsolved murders.
Now going by the name Peter Coonan, the 70-year-old was convicted of 13 murders and is serving a whole life sentence. It is reported that police will return to Durham prison later this month for further questioning.
